A small country emits 66,000 kilotons of carbon dioxide per year. In a recent global agreement, the country agreed to cut its carbon emissions by 4% per year for the next 11 years. In the first year of the agreement, the country will keep its emissions at 66,000 kilotons and the emissions will decrease 4% in each successive year. How many total kilotons of carbon dioxide would the country emit over the course of the 11 year period, to the nearest whole number?
